Bergen is a mid-sized city of roughly 285,000 people with both the sea and mountains close by in Norway. The climate is temperate. It has a lively, popular feel and is considered very safe. A typical month of living costs around $2,900. Healthcare is strong, and the internet is fast enough for full-time remote work. People come here for hiking, skiing, live music.
